In 1927, the Governmental recognition of the Scout Association gave the Scouts of Cuba the same rights as other
official bodies, including free postage. The free postage privilege was allowed until the revolution ended Scouting
in Cuba in 1959. The Boy Scout Headquarter in Venezuela enjoyed a free postage privilege for domestic letters.
